What are the techniques used in invasive plant management?
Invasive Plant Control Methods Biological Control Methods. Biological controls use plant diseases or insect predators, typically from the targeted species' home range. Mechanical Control Methods. Pulling and Digging. Suffocation. Cutting or Mowing. Chemical Control Methods. Cultural Control Methods. Integrated Pest Management.

What is the abbreviation for invasive plant science and management?
Invasive Plant Science and Management (IPSM) is an online peer-reviewed journal focusing on fundamental and applied research on invasive plant biology, ecology, management, and restoration of invaded non-crop areas, and on other aspects relevant to invasive species, including educational activities and policy issues.
What is the best way to manage invasive species?
Herbicides are among the most effective and resource-efficient tools to treat invasive species. Most of the commonly known invasive plants can be treated using only two herbicides — glyphosate (the active ingredient in Roundup™ and Rodeo™) and triclopyr (the active ingredient in Brush-BGone™ and Garlon™).
What makes invasive plants successful?
Many invasive plant species produce large quantities of seed. Many invasives thrive on disturbed soil. Invasive plant seeds are often distributed by birds, wind, or unknowingly humans allowing seed to moving great distances. Some invasives have aggressive root systems that spread long distances from a single plant.
